hitetlen.com > Scriptek > Előreszámláló megadott órara pontosan

Előreszámláló megadott órara pontosan

Érdekessége ennek a visszaszámlálónak az,
hogy egy általad megadott Év.Hónap.Nap és órához igazodva számol előre.
(tehát nem éjfélig)

Demo jelenleg látható:

HTML Kód:


A Script a Greenwichi Középidőhöz igazodik. (Greenwich Mean Time - GMT)
Magyarország +1 időzónához van sorolva.
Mivel nyári időszámítás szerint, még +1 órát kell hozzáadni az aktuális időhöz, ezért a kódban télen nyáron állítanod kell az időpontot. (télen GMT+1)

Erről a sorról van szó:
var strEventDate = new Date("August 06, 2006 14:00:00 GMT+2");

Két ilyen Script egy oldalon "összekad" és tehát nem működik,
ezért a függvények nevét át kell írnod pl. a második Scriptben.

Pl. a második Script így nézzen ki.
(a függvények más nevet adtam, hozzáírtam egy kettest.)

<script language="JavaScript"  type="text/javascript">

document.write('A hitetlen.com megnyitásától eltelt idő :<br><b><div id="winerCountdown2"></div></b>');

winerClockCountdown2();

function toDateString(strTempString) {
 strReturnString = "";
 if (strTempString < 10) {
  strReturnString += "0";
 }
 return strReturnString + strTempString.toString();
}
 
function winerClockCountdown2() {
 var strEventDate = new Date("September 03, 2005 14:00:00 GMT");
// cl = document.clock;
 newDate = new Date();
 intCount = Math.floor((strEventDate.getTime() - newDate.getTime())/1000);
 if(intCount <= 0) {
  return;
 }

 intSeconds = toDateString(intCount % 60);
 intCount = Math.floor(intCount / 60);
 intMinutes = toDateString(intCount % 60);
 intCount = Math.floor(intCount / 60);
 intHours = toDateString(intCount % 24);
 intCount = Math.floor(intCount / 24);
 intDays = intCount;   

 document.getElementById("winerCountdown2").innerHTML =
  intDays + " Nap, " +
  intHours + " Óra, " +
  intMinutes + " Perc, " +
  intSeconds + " Másodperc";
  
 setTimeout("winerClockCountdown2();", 500);
 
}

</script>

Figyelem!A hónapok nevét csak angolul fogadja el:
January
February
March
April
May
June
July
August
September
October
November
December

Scriptek

  1. március 27th, 2008 17:17-nél | #1

    A script nagyon jó! Ha helyett -t használunk, szÜkség esetén egy sorba is szerkeszthető. Ld.: http://www.vfmk.hu {a láblécben}

  2. március 27th, 2008 17:18-nél | #2

    A tagek nem jelentek meg. Szóval, ha div helyett span-t használunk!

  3. június 11th, 2008 15:09-nél | #3

    Sziasztok. Azt szeretném kérdezni, hogy mit kell át írni még ahhoz hogy megjelenjen, mert nekem nem akar megjelenni. És hogy kell, hogy tetszőleges időpontról induljon, és csak a napot mutatsa? Mert annyira nem értek hozzá…. Előre is köszi a segítséget.

  4. június 11th, 2008 15:22-nél | #4

    Az a legjobb ha elkÜlditek e-mailben…

  5. június 11th, 2008 15:33-nél | #5

    Rájöttem hogy kell, hogy csak a napot mutatsa, meg minden, de még mindig nem jelenik meg a honlapomon… Itt megnéztem a HTML-kódok kipróbálásánál, ott látszott…Az oldalon kell valamit változtatni?

  6. július 1st, 2008 11:52-nél | #6

    Miért nem látszik ez az internet exploreren sem?? a firefoxon sem, meg semmin..

  7. december 23rd, 2008 02:03-nél | #7

    abban tudnátok segíteni, hogy a színt azt hogyan tudom beállítani? köszönöm. és nagyon tetszik az egész oldal! Amatőr létemre is nagyon tudom használni!

  8. január 16th, 2009 18:27-nél | #8

    Még mindig nem működik…..Se Exploreren..Se firefoxon nem látszik.. Mi lehet a baj??? Bármilyen HTML szerkesztésű honlapra be lehet illeszteni??? LÉCCCI….mondjátok meg mit tegyek vele hogy működjön!! Köszi…

  9. szekra
    június 10th, 2010 15:29-nél | #9

    valami baj van…. nem vayok javas, igy valaki megnezhetne. nem megy sem ie-n, se firefoxon. . ..

  10. Csokesz
    szeptember 24th, 2010 00:18-nél | #10

    Miért nem müködik? Nem mutat semmit?
    Hova kell beirni, hogy lehessen látni?
    Köszi!

  1. Még nincsenek visszakövetések

Elakadtál? Kérj segítséget itt!
Még több Scriptek (18 összesen 121 cikkek)


Spam elleni védelemvar code=""function generatecode() { var fulladdress=document.codeform.emailname.value var splitaddress=fulladdress.split("@") var ml=splitaddress[0] var mr=splitaddress[1] var ma="@" code=' /*A Script itt ...